The use of satellite for water applications in agriculture: a review

da Cunha, Samuel Rodrigues; Guimaraes, Gabriel do Nascimento

Abstract

Many efforts have been made to understand climatic and hydrological variables' variability, magnitude, and standards. In this sense, spatial data has been a fundamentally important tool in supporting the development of agriculture and environmental management research. We start this review by giving a brief overview of the use of satellites in Brazilian agriculture. Besides that, we present a couple of examples of satellite applications in managing water resources in agriculture. The second part of this review illustrates a detailed scenario concerning the orbital sensors available for water applications in agriculture. Finally, we provide a synthesis of the future of satellites in agriculture in terms of nanosatellites, artificial intelligence, and onboard processing.
